Republic of the PhilippinesSUPREME COURT
SECOND DIVISION
G.R. Nos. L-57627 & 58966 May 31, 1985
ROLANDO TINIO, petitioner, JUDGE JOSE P. CASTRO, Court of First Instance of Quezon City, and ANNA H. QUINTAL, respondents.
Antonio Quintos for petitioner.
Benjamin M. Tan for respondent Anna H. Quintal.
R E S O L U T I O N
AQUINO, J.:
This is an ejectment case. Rolando Tinio, the tenant, in his petition dated August 6, 1981 prayed that the sheriff of Quezon City be enjoined from executing the judgment of the city court of Quezon City dated November 14, 1979 ejecting him (G. R. No. 57627).
In his petition dated November 25, 1981 Tinio prayed that said judgment be set aside (G. R. No. 58966).
Anna H. Quintal the landlady, owner of the premises at 79 C. Salvador Street, Loyola Heights, Quezon City, answered both petitions. The cases were submitted for decision.
On May 17, 1985 the parties filed a joint motion praying that the two cases be dismissed for having become moot and academic because Tinio had vacated the premises and the possession thereof had already been delivered to Anna.
WHEREFORE, these two cases are dismissed without costs.
SO ORDERED.
Makasiar (Chairman), Abad Santos, Escolin and Cuevas, JJ., concur.
Concepcion Jr., J., took no part.
Rolando Tinio vs. J. Jose P. Castro
This is an ejectment case (civil) between Rolando Tinio (tenant) and Anna H. Quintal (landlady) involving the premises at 79 C. Salvador Street, Loyola Heights, Quezon City. Tinio filed two petitions: one to enjoin the execution of the ejectment judgment and another to set aside the judgment. Both parties submitted their answers and the cases were submitted for decision. However, before the decision was reached, the parties filed a joint motion to dismiss the cases as they had become moot and academic because Tinio had already vacated the premises and possession had been delivered to Anna. The Supreme Court granted the motion and dismissed the cases without costs. (Makasiar, Abad Santos, Escolin and Cuevas, JJ., concur; Concepcion Jr., J., took no part.)
